Winter Fancy Food Show Finds: extravaGONZO Gourmet Foods

extravaGONZO Gourmet Foods just introduced a unique line of culinary oils at the Winter Fancy Food Show, January 22-24, at the Moscone Center in San Francisco.

The flavors include Jalapeño Lime, Roasted Garlic, Meyer Lemon and Blood Orange. By using a blend of 80% extra virgin and 20% grapeseed oils, extravaGONZO fused in ingredients in an unparalleled way, giving them a bright and bold flavor unlike other oils on the market. The collection also includes classic red and white balsamic vinegars, from Modena, Italy, aged to syrupy perfection

“The GONZO philosophy is minimal ingredients, maximum taste,” states owner Tom Stevens. “My motto is bold flavors for bold people, not for the fancy or faint at heart. I ensure that the product line will be a palate pleaser to all — from the seasoned chef who labors over his/her creations, to the parent who comes home from work and has just a few moments to throw a quick meal together.”

Roasted Garlic turns up the taste on everything from steaks to seafood and pasta to dressings, while a drizzle will do wonders for popcorn, pizza and roasted potatoes. Blood Orange will do the same for poultry, pork and fish, with a short pour adding lip-smacking tang to dressings, potatoes and roasted veggies. Meyer Lemon is perfect for giving a summery fresh complement to chicken, fish and lamb, while a splash will enliven roasted veggies, potatoes and dressings. And to add a perfect punch to poultry, seafood and steaks on the grill, use Jalapeño Lime.

Just One More Week of Melting Pot's Restaurant Week!

The Melting Pot is debuting a new menu for their Restaurant Week and you have just one more week to get there and enjoy creamy garlicky cheese fondue, fresh crisp salads, spicy and flavorful seafood and meats, and warm, melty chocolate fondue for dessert! 

Four courses for $35 a person- that’s amazing for such a delicious meal.

Steve and I began with drinks in our special reserved booth, and I get my signature drink, the Strawberry Blonde. 

We elected to try the special Restaurant Week menu, starting with the pesto walnut Swiss cheese fondue- with Fontina, Raclette, Gruyère and Parmesan cheeses. 

This was excellent- the walnuts were just enough to give a nutty crunch, and the pesto added smooth undertones that complemented the Swiss cheese. 

Cheesy fondue
We dunked in with rye, sourdough, and Pumpernickel breads, pretzel bread, apples, and veggies.

The second course, a fresh arugula salad with sliced pears, Gorgonzola cheese, honey-roasted almonds and dried cranberries tossed with the Melting Pot’s homemade champagne vinaigrette.

The Wayne entree
The third course offered three delightful selections to choose from: 

The Wayne- jalapeno filet mignon, pacific white shrimp, herb coated chicken breast, and chicken-n-cabbage pot stickers;

The King of Prussia- cold water lobster tail, filet mignon, and Siracha lime shrimp;

The Audubon- herb coated chicken breast, pacific white shrimp, Atlantic salmon & sesame wasabi-coated Ahi tuna.

Steve enjoyed the Wayne while I enjoyed the King of Prussia entrees in the coq au vin cooking style.

For dessert- oh dessert!- we got the German chocolate fondue milk chocolate topped with pecans and drizzled with caramel.
